PUBS
The SHIP INN, Middlestone, lies on the
RED ROUTE. You can get drink and food providing that you arrive at an appropriate hour.
If you are prepared to deviate from the route by a few hundred metres:
To the NE of the RED ROUTE lies the ancient village of Kirk Merrington,
which at the last count had a selection of 4 public houses.
To the SE of the RED ROUTE is the Sportsmans Arms at Canney Hill,
welcoming families and serving good pub food.
If its good beer you're after then The Frog and Ferret, 6 miles away next to 'Thorns' roundabout at Spennymoor,
takes some beating. It is a small traditional pub, children are not encouraged.
In the other direction, toward Crook, in the village of North Bitchburn, The Red Lion serves excellent real ale
